This happened to the Indonesian Dota 2 team “Mix Elite” which was struggling in the IESF World Championship 2021.
They are considered walkout due to poor connections in this Southeast Asian qualifying round.

Previously, Muhammad Rizky (IYD), Rudy Lucky (USAGI), Ramzi Bayhaki (Gracia), Tri Kuncoro (Jhocam), and Muhammad Luthfi (Azura), faced the Philippines team on November 9.
At that time, they were also absent because they were considered late or had passed the agreed match time.

The IESF World Championship 2021 Southeast Asia qualification itself was participated by 5 countries, namely Indonesia, Vietnam, the Philippines, Myanmar, and Thailand.
Not only Dota 2, IESF World Championship 2021 also competes with other esports branches such as PES 2021 and Tekken 7.
